To study the incidence and characteristics of ciliochoroidal detachment (CCD) at different time points following minimally invasive glaucoma surgery in patients with primary open-angle glaucoma (POAG).</p></sec><sec><title>METHODS</title><p>METHODS. Among 4 513 patients who underwent surgery for POAG between 2020 and 2024, 75 patients (75 eyes; 1.7%) with postoperative CCD were selected. The mean age was 73.5±8.8 years. Two groups were formed: group 1 (54 patients) with CCD developing within the first 3 days after glaucoma surgery, and group 2 (21 patients) with CCD developing later than 3 days postoperatively.</p></sec><sec><title>RESULTS</title><p>RESULTS. CCD developed more frequently within the first 3 days after glaucoma surgery (54 vs 21 eyes). Early CCD occurred more often in men (38 vs 16), whereas no sex differences were observed in late CCD. No significant differences between groups were found in mean age, ocular morphometric parameters, POAG stages, structure of somatic pathology, glaucoma duration, baseline and postoperative intraocular pressure, or the number and classes of medications used. Late CCD occurred more frequently after cyclophotocoagulation (19% vs 1.9%, p=0.031). Early CCD showed no characteristic features regarding the prevalence of subchoroidal fluid, whereas late CCD was typically limited to 1–2 quadrants (81%).</p></sec><sec><title>CONCLUSION</title><p>CONCLUSION. The identified differences in the development of CCD depending on the time period after glaucoma surgery have clinical relevance for its timely diagnosis and treatment.</p></sec></trans-abstract><kwd-group xml:lang="ru"><kwd>цилиохориоидальная отслойка</kwd><kwd>первичная открытоугольная глаукома</kwd><kwd>миниинвазивная хирургия глаукомы</kwd></kwd-group><kwd-group xml:lang="en"><kwd>ciliochoroidal detachment</kwd><kwd>primary openangle glaucoma</kwd><kwd>minimally invasive glaucoma surgery</kwd></kwd-group></article-meta></front><back><ref-list><title>References</title><ref id="cit1"><label>1</label><citation-alternatives><mixed-citation xml:lang="ru">Бабушкин А.Э., Матюхина Е.Н.
